Postdoctoral positions
Cutting-edge research in an industry environment
Our Presidential Postdoctoral Fellowship program provides talented scientists with a unique opportunity to perform high-quality research in an environment with the resources of a large pharmaceutical company. Each year, innovative scientists from academia are selected to become fellows and collaborate with leading pharmaceutical discovery scientists pursuing multidisciplinary research projects. Together, they apply their expertise to discovering new medicines that will help patients lead healthier lives.

Scientific training, mentoring, and opportunities
The program provides rigorous scientific training, while supporting flexibility in the fellow’s future career options in industry or academia. Fellows design their own research plan and receive guidance from two mentors: a senior researcher at NIBR and a faculty member from an academic institution. Fellows are expected to publish their work in peer-reviewed journals and present their research at international scientific meetings. They also have regular opportunities to present their work within Novartis and interact with NIBR scientific leaders.
Fellows are appointed to a 3-year term and may conduct research at one of our global sites:
- Basel, Switzerland,
- Cambridge, Massachusetts, United States,
- East Hanover, New Jersey, United States,
- Emeryville, California, United States,
- Horsham, England, or
- Shanghai, China.
The application process: interviews and research proposal
Graduate students within one year of completing their doctoral work and postdoctoral fellows nearing completion of their first postdoctoral training period (within two years of obtaining their Ph.D.) are eligible to apply. If selected, the candidate will have an initial interview with a member of the presidential postdoctoral program team. The second stage includes a full-day, on-site interview, during which the candidate conducts a research seminar and meets potential NIBR mentors and current postdoctoral fellows. Lastly, the candidate submits a research proposal written in close collaboration with their NIBR and academic mentors.
